連続波(CW)レーダーの世界市場は2030年までに米国で144億米ドルに達する見込み

2024年に108億米ドルと推定される連続波(CW)レーダーの世界市場は、2024年から2030年にかけてCAGR 4.9%で成長し、2030年には144億米ドルに達すると予測されます。本レポートで分析したセグメントの1つである商業分野は、CAGR 5.0%を記録し、分析期間終了までに81億米ドルに達すると予測されます。防衛セグメントの成長率は、分析期間中CAGR 4.8%と推定されます。

米国市場は28億米ドルと推定、中国はCAGR 7.5%で成長予測

米国の連続波(CW)レーダー市場は、2024年に28億米ドルと推定されます。世界第2位の経済大国である中国は、2030年までに32億米ドルの市場規模に達すると予測され、分析期間2024-2030年のCAGRは7.5%です。その他の注目すべき地域別市場としては、日本とカナダがあり、分析期間中のCAGRはそれぞれ2.9%と4.0%と予測されています。欧州では、ドイツがCAGR 3.5%で成長すると予測されています。

連続波(CW)レーダーとは何か、なぜ現代のセンシングに不可欠なのか?

連続波(CW)レーダーはレーダーシステムの一種であり、電磁波を継続的に放射して移動する物体を探知、位置特定、追跡します。バースト・エネルギーを放射するパルス・レーダーとは異なり、CWレーダーは連続信号を使用し、ドップラー効果による周波数シフトを解析することで物体の速度を測定します。このため、CWレーダーは速度検出や目標追跡、正確な速度測定を必要とする用途に特に有効です。CWレーダーは、軍事・防衛、自動車、航空宇宙、気象、交通取締、産業オートメーションなど幅広い分野で使用されています。

CWレーダーの需要は、民間と軍事の両方の用途において、移動物体に関するリアルタイムで正確なデータを提供する能力により、著しく伸びています。防衛分野では、CWレーダーはミサイル誘導、標的追跡、戦場監視に使用されています。自動車用途では、CWレーダーはアダプティブ・クルーズ・コントロール(ACC)、衝突回避、自律走行システムに不可欠であり、車速と車間距離の正確な測定は安全にとって極めて重要です。交通管理では、CWレーダーは速度取締りや道路交通パターンの監視に使用され、より安全で効率的な交通システムに貢献しています。CWレーダーの多用途性、精度、信頼性により、CWレーダーはさまざまな最新のセンシングおよび検出アプリケーションにおいて不可欠なツールとなっています。

技術の進歩は連続波レーダーの開発をどのように形成しているか?

技術の進歩により、連続波(CW)レーダーの性能、汎用性、用途は大幅に改善され、多様な検知ニーズに対してより効果的なものとなっています。主な技術革新の一つは、周波数変調連続波(FMCW)レーダーの開発です。FMCWレーダーは、連続信号に周波数変調を加えることで、距離と速度の両方の測定を可能にします。FMCWレーダーは、物体の距離と速度の検出において、より高い解像度とより高い精度を提供し、正確な距離測定が重要な自動車安全システム、ドローン、ミサイル誘導などの用途で特に有用です。

もうひとつの大きな進歩は、CWレーダー・システムにデジタル信号処理(DSP)と機械学習アルゴリズムが統合されたことです。DSPは、大量のデータを迅速に処理する能力を強化し、信号の明瞭化、ノイズ除去、ターゲット識別を向上させる。機械学習アルゴリズムは、レーダー信号のインテリジェントなフィルタリングと解釈を可能にし、特定の物体を識別し、ターゲットを区別し、潜在的な脅威をより正確に検出するレーダーの能力を向上させます。このようなAIを活用した処理の統合により、監視、国境警備、自律航行など、迅速かつ正確な意思決定が求められる分野でのCWレーダーの利用が拡大しています。

レーダー・コンポーネントの小型化と、窒化ガリウム(GaN)や炭化ケイ素(SiC)などの先端半導体技術の使用により、CWレーダーの電力効率、探知距離、感度が向上しました。これらの技術革新は、無人航空機(UAV)、携帯型軍事機器、小型自律走行車での使用に適した、より小型で軽量なレーダー・システムの実現につながりました。さらに、フェーズドアレイ技術の進歩により、電子ビームステアリング、より高速なターゲット追尾、より正確な方向スキャンが可能になり、CWレーダーの能力が向上しました。また、IoTコネクティビティの統合により、CWレーダーシステムの遠隔操作と監視が改善され、リアルタイム・アプリケーションへの汎用性と適応性が高まりました。こうした技術的進歩は、CWレーダーの有効性と信頼性を向上させただけでなく、軍事、自動車、産業分野での用途を拡大し、より正確な探知と状況認識の強化をサポートしています。

連続波レーダー市場の成長を促す要因とは?

連続波(CW)レーダー市場の成長は、防衛費の増加、自動車安全システムの拡大、自律走行車技術の進歩、インテリジェントな交通管理に対する需要の高まりなど、いくつかの要因によってもたらされています。高度な監視・防衛システムに対するニーズの高まりは、軍事用途におけるCWレーダーの需要に拍車をかけており、CWレーダーは標的捕捉、ミサイル誘導、戦場監視などに使用されています。航空攻撃、ドローン、弾道ミサイルの脅威が高まっていることも、CWレーダーへの投資を後押ししています。CWレーダーは、現代の防衛戦略に不可欠な正確な追跡とリアルタイムデータを提供します。

自動車産業、特にADAS(先進運転支援システム)や自律走行車の拡大が、CWレーダーの需要増加に寄与しています。安全規制が厳しくなり、より安全な自動車に対する消費者の要求が高まる中、自動車メーカーはアダプティブ・クルーズ・コントロール、衝突回避、歩行者検知のためにCWレーダー技術を自動車に搭載するケースが増えています。自動運転車の開発もFMCWレーダーの採用を後押ししています。FMCWレーダーは距離と速度の両方を検出できるため、リアルタイムのナビゲーションや障害物回避に不可欠です。

スマートシティとインテリジェント交通システムの台頭は、交通管理におけるCWレーダーの新たな機会を生み出しました。CWレーダーは、速度取締り、渋滞監視、交通信号の最適化などに使用され、交通の安全と効率を向上させています。さらに、産業オートメーションとロボット工学もCWレーダー技術の恩恵を受けています。CWレーダーは、自動化された製造環境における正確な移動制御、物体検出、操作の安全性を可能にするからです。新興市場、特にアジア太平洋と中東では、防衛インフラ、自動車生産、スマートシティプロジェクトが急成長しており、CWレーダーの需要をさらに押し上げています。技術革新が進み、防衛、自動車、スマートインフラでの用途が拡大し、安全性と効率性への需要が高まる中、CWレーダー市場は、進化するセキュリティニーズ、自動化における世界の進歩、次世代センシングソリューションへの投資の高まりなどを背景に、持続的な成長を遂げる構えです。

Global Continuous Wave (CW) Radars Market to Reach US$14.4 Billion by 2030

The global market for Continuous Wave (CW) Radars estimated at US$10.8 Billion in the year 2024, is expected to reach US$14.4 Billion by 2030, growing at a CAGR of 4.9% over the analysis period 2024-2030. Commercial, one of the segments analyzed in the report, is expected to record a 5.0% CAGR and reach US$8.1 Billion by the end of the analysis period. Growth in the Defense segment is estimated at 4.8% CAGR over the analysis period.

The U.S. Market is Estimated at US$2.8 Billion While China is Forecast to Grow at 7.5% CAGR

The Continuous Wave (CW) Radars market in the U.S. is estimated at US$2.8 Billion in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$3.2 Billion by the year 2030 trailing a CAGR of 7.5%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 2.9% and 4.0%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 3.5% CAGR.

What Are Continuous Wave (CW) Radars & Why Are They Vital in Modern Sensing?

Continuous Wave (CW) radars are a type of radar system that continuously emit electromagnetic waves to detect, locate, and track moving objects. Unlike pulsed radars, which emit bursts of energy, CW radars use a continuous signal to measure the velocity of objects by analyzing the frequency shift caused by the Doppler effect. This makes CW radars especially effective for speed detection, target tracking, and applications requiring precise velocity measurements. CW radars are used in a wide range of sectors, including military and defense, automotive, aerospace, meteorology, traffic enforcement, and industrial automation.

The demand for CW radars has grown significantly due to their ability to provide real-time, accurate data on moving objects in both civilian and military applications. In defense, CW radars are used for missile guidance, target tracking, and battlefield surveillance. In automotive applications, CW radars are integral to adaptive cruise control (ACC), collision avoidance, and autonomous vehicle systems, where precise measurement of vehicle speed and distance is crucial for safety. In traffic management, CW radars are used for speed enforcement and monitoring road traffic patterns, contributing to safer and more efficient transportation systems. The versatility, accuracy, and reliability of CW radars make them a vital tool in various modern sensing and detection applications.

How Are Technological Advancements Shaping the Development of Continuous Wave Radars?

Technological advancements have significantly improved the performance, versatility, and applications of Continuous Wave (CW) radars, making them more effective for diverse detection needs. One of the key innovations is the development of Frequency-Modulated Continuous Wave (FMCW) radars, which add frequency modulation to the continuous signal, allowing for the measurement of both range and velocity. FMCW radars provide higher resolution and better accuracy in detecting the distance and speed of objects, making them particularly useful in applications like automotive safety systems, drones, and missile guidance, where precise range measurements are critical.

Another significant advancement is the integration of digital signal processing (DSP) and machine learning algorithms in CW radar systems. DSP enhances the ability to process large volumes of data quickly, improving signal clarity, noise reduction, and target identification. Machine learning algorithms enable intelligent filtering and interpretation of radar signals, enhancing the radar’s capability to identify specific objects, differentiate between targets, and detect potential threats more accurately. This integration of AI-powered processing has expanded the use of CW radars in areas like surveillance, border security, and autonomous navigation, where quick and accurate decision-making is required.

The miniaturization of radar components and the use of advanced semiconductor technologies, such as gallium nitride (GaN) and silicon carbide (SiC), have improved the power efficiency, range, and sensitivity of CW radars. These innovations have led to more compact and lightweight radar systems that are suitable for use in unmanned aerial vehicles (UAVs), portable military devices, and small autonomous vehicles. In addition, advancements in phased array technology have enhanced the capabilities of CW radars by enabling electronic beam steering, faster target tracking, and more precise directional scanning. The integration of IoT connectivity has also improved the remote operation and monitoring of CW radar systems, making them more versatile and adaptable for real-time applications. These technological advancements have not only increased the effectiveness and reliability of CW radars but have also expanded their applications across military, automotive, and industrial sectors, supporting more accurate detection and enhanced situational awareness.

What Factors Are Driving Growth in the Continuous Wave Radars Market?

The growth in the Continuous Wave (CW) radars market is driven by several factors, including increasing defense spending, expanding automotive safety systems, advancements in autonomous vehicle technology, and rising demand for intelligent traffic management. The growing need for advanced surveillance and defense systems has fueled demand for CW radars in military applications, where they are used for target acquisition, missile guidance, and battlefield monitoring. The rising threat of aerial attacks, drones, and ballistic missiles has further encouraged investments in CW radars, which provide accurate tracking and real-time data essential for modern defense strategies.

The expanding automotive industry, particularly in advanced driver-assistance systems (ADAS) and autonomous vehicles, has contributed to increased demand for CW radars. With safety regulations becoming stricter and consumer demand for safer vehicles growing, automakers are increasingly incorporating CW radar technology into vehicles for adaptive cruise control, collision avoidance, and pedestrian detection. The development of self-driving vehicles has also driven the adoption of FMCW radars, which offer both range and velocity detection, making them critical for real-time navigation and obstacle avoidance.

The rise of smart cities and intelligent transportation systems has created new opportunities for CW radars in traffic management. CW radars are used for speed enforcement, congestion monitoring, and optimizing traffic signals, improving road safety and efficiency. Additionally, industrial automation and robotics have benefited from CW radar technology, as it enables precise movement control, object detection, and operational safety in automated manufacturing environments. Emerging markets, particularly in Asia-Pacific and the Middle East, are experiencing rapid growth in defense infrastructure, automotive production, and smart city projects, further driving demand for CW radars. With ongoing technological innovations, expanding applications in defense, automotive, and smart infrastructure, and increasing demand for safety and efficiency, the CW radars market is poised for sustained growth, driven by evolving security needs, global advancements in automation, and rising investments in next-generation sensing solutions.
